Arnold Palmer Signed 1970 'Arnold Palmer Enterprises' Letter with Envelope


R.I.P. to The King. We'll never see anyone in golf as beloved as Arnold Palmer, and his career accomplishments are overshadowed by his impact on the game. The late Palmer passed away Sunday, September 25 at age 87. Arnold Palmer leaves his signature on this 1970 letter addressed to W.J. Schindler, with its envelope included. Palmer wrote the letter on an 'Arnold Palmer Enterprises' letterhead dated September 3, 1970 and signed at the bottom in pen. Any autographs by The King command attention, and this item is no exception. See photos for details on content of the letter and condition.

James Spence Authentication (JSA) has reviewed this autograph and their certification of its authenticity will come with this lot.
